Master of Science in Civil Engineering

The Master of Science in Civil Engineering can help you develop the skills needed to create the next generation. The online master's degree program is 100% online. It teaches you how infrastructure can be designed using data-driven strategies that achieve maximum safety, durability and sustainability. The program includes courses in soil stabilization, structural dynamics and foundations as well as pavement design and structural mechanics.

The program requires that students have a bachelor's in Civil Engineering or another related field to apply. They must have at least 50% marks from their undergraduate degrees. Admissions committees also consider the student's performance on an entrance exam. Graduate assistantships are student jobs that require students to work a specific number of hours per week and must be applied for by students. Graduate assistantships may include tuition waivers as well as a monthly living wage.

To enroll in a master's degree program in civil engineering, you must have a bachelor's degree in civil engineering and have strong mathematics and science backgrounds. Applicants who do not have the required undergraduate background may be accepted conditionally. In these cases, you can complete a bridge program, which consists of additional courses above and beyond the regular degree requirements.

Athletic teams

Milwaukee School of Engineering is expanding their athletic offerings to include softball as well as baseball. It plans to build a new stadium with seating for 250 fans on the downtown MSOE campus, near North Milwaukee and East State streets. The stadium will also have batting cages and dugouts. Construction of the stadium is expected by the 2023 spring season.


MSOE is an NCAA Division III college and its athletic teams compete with other collegiate teams in Northern Athletics Collegiate Conference. The school offers intramural, club, and varsity sports for its students. More than 30 clubs and organizations are located on campus.

The Milwaukee School of Engineering is a private, nonprofit university that offers bachelor's degrees in engineering, business, and nursing. Faculty members at the school are committed to creating a supportive environment for students. Students can expect personalized service, instruction, and academic excellence.

Curriculum

The curriculum for MSOE civil engineering degree is designed to prepare students to be professionals in the field. These professionals are responsible for constructing the infrastructure needed by modern society. Students will gain expertise in engineering principles and practices, mathematics, natural sciences, business, public policy, and leadership. These skills will prepare them for careers that involve designing and estimating construction projects, as well as air pollution and solid waste resource recovery.

The MSOE civil engineer program offers several specialization options. These range from structural and environmental engineering to water resources engineering. Students can take evening classes if they need. Students may also choose to pursue a minor in a related discipline.

Lean Production System

Six key concepts underlie the lean production system.

  • Flow - The focus is on moving information and material as close as possible to customers.
  • Value stream mapping - break down each stage of a process into discrete tasks and create a flowchart of the entire process;
  • Five S's – Sort, Put In Order Shine, Standardize and Sustain
  • Kanban - use visual signals such as colored tape, stickers, or other visual cues to keep track of inventory;
  • Theory of constraints: Identify bottlenecks and use lean tools such as kanban boards to eliminate them.
  • Just-in time - Get components and materials delivered right at the point of usage;
  • Continuous improvement: Make incremental improvements to the process instead of overhauling it completely.
